Stroke Course 2025 | March 29, 2025

For interventional radiologists interested or experienced in cerebral angiography, carotid revascularization, and/or endovascular stroke thrombectomy, the 2025 SIR Stroke Course will provide participants with the latest in stroke education offering more than 8.5 hours of CME credit. Topics from the multidisciplinary faculty include stroke pathophysiology, the latest updates on stroke trials, emerging areas for endovascular thrombectomy, challenging interventions in refractory and tandem occlusion cases, and case presentations.
